Top nutrients that support the body

For 100 g, the strongest Daily Value contributions among nutrients available in this record are Niacin (B3) (96.3% DV), Vitamin B12 (79.2% DV) and Selenium (66.4% DV). The cards explain the normal roles of those nutrients, not a treatment effect of the food.

Niacin (B3): energy and cell function

96.3% adult DV in 100 g
Energy metabolismCell function

This amount provides 15.4 mg. Niacin helps enzymes convert food into energy and supports normal cell function. This describes the nutrient’s normal role, not disease prevention or treatment.

Vitamin B12: blood cells and nerves

79.2% adult DV in 100 g
Red blood cellsNervous system

This amount provides 1.9 µg. Vitamin B12 supports healthy blood cells, DNA synthesis and normal nervous-system function. This describes the nutrient’s normal role, not disease prevention or treatment.

Selenium: thyroid and antioxidant defense

66.4% adult DV in 100 g
Thyroid functionAntioxidant defense

This amount provides 36.5 µg. Selenium supports thyroid hormone metabolism, DNA synthesis and protection from oxidative damage. This describes the nutrient’s normal role, not disease prevention or treatment.

Vitamin B6: metabolism and brain development

50% adult DV in 100 g
MetabolismBrain and immune function

This amount provides 0.85 mg. Vitamin B6 supports many enzyme reactions involved in metabolism, brain development and immune function. This describes the nutrient’s normal role, not disease prevention or treatment.

Phosphorus: bones and cellular energy

17.8% adult DV in 100 g
Bones and teethCellular energy

This amount provides 222 mg. Phosphorus helps form bones and teeth and is involved in energy production and cell membranes. This describes the nutrient’s normal role, not disease prevention or treatment.
